定制外包开发app好吗?APP开发外包优缺点分析

2025-05-06 25

定制外包开发APP是否合适,取决于企业的具体需求、预算、开发周期等因素。以下是对外包开发APP的优缺点分析,供您参考:


一、外包开发APP的优点

  1. 降低成本

    • 无需自建技术团队,节省招聘、培训、薪资等长期成本。
    • 外包公司通常有成熟的开发流程,能减少试错成本。
  2. 缩短开发周期

    • 专业团队经验丰富,能快速启动项目并避免技术弯路。
    • 多人协作开发,效率通常高于临时组建的内部团队。
  3. 技术实力保障

    • 外包公司拥有多领域技术人才(如UI设计、后端开发、测试等),可应对复杂功能需求(如支付、即时通讯、AI集成等)。
    • 对行业技术和政策(如隐私合规、应用商店审核规则)更熟悉。
  4. 风险转移

    • 开发延期、技术瓶颈等问题主要由外包方承担。
    • 合同约束下,交付质量和时间更有保障。
  5. 后期维护灵活

    • 多数外包公司提供运维支持(如BUG修复、版本更新),适合无技术团队的企业。

二、外包开发APP的缺点

  1. 沟通与管理成本高

    • 需求理解偏差可能导致反复修改,增加时间成本。
    • 跨团队协作时,进度同步和决策效率可能较低。
  2. 质量控制依赖外包方

    • 若外包团队技术能力不足,可能交付代码质量差、扩展性低的项目,影响后续迭代。
    • 需严格验收测试,否则隐藏问题可能后期爆发。
  3. 数据与代码安全风险

    • 核心代码和用户数据由外包方掌握,存在泄露风险(需通过合同约束)。
    • 若外包公司倒闭或人员变动,可能影响后续维护。
  4. 长期成本可能更高

    • 后续功能升级或调整需额外付费,长期依赖外包可能导致总成本超过自建团队。
  5. 知识产权归属问题

    • 需在合同中明确代码所有权,避免纠纷。

三、适合外包开发的情况

  1. 预算有限:短期项目或初创企业资金紧张。
  2. 时间紧迫:需快速上线验证市场。
  3. 技术门槛高:需区块链、AR/VR等专业能力。
  4. 无技术团队:缺乏自主开发能力的中小企业。

四、如何选择靠谱的外包公司?

  1. 明确需求文档:清晰列出功能清单、技术要求和交付标准。
  2. 考察案例与口碑:优先选择有同类项目经验的公司,查看用户评价。
  3. 合同细节:明确交付周期、付款方式、违约责任、代码所有权等。
  4. 分阶段验收:按里程碑付款(如原型确认、测试版本验收)。
  5. 建立沟通机制:定期会议同步进度,减少信息差。
  6. 保护知识产权:合同需注明代码、设计稿等成果归属权。

五、

  • 短期项目/初创企业:外包开发性价比高,可快速试错。
  • 长期复杂项目/成熟企业:建议自建团队,便于迭代和把控核心数据。
  • 关键点:选择可靠的外包团队,通过合同规避风险,并预留预算应对后续需求变动。

最终需根据企业资源、项目定位和长期规划综合权衡。如果选择外包,建议从需求梳理阶段开始严格管理,确保项目可控。

(牛站网络)Image

1. 本站所有资源来源于用户上传和网络,因此不包含技术服务请大家谅解!如有侵权请邮件联系客服!cheeksyu@vip.qq.com
2. 本站不保证所提供下载的资源的准确性、安全性和完整性,资源仅供下载学习之用!如有链接无法下载、失效或广告,请联系客服处理!
3. 您必须在下载后的24个小时之内,从您的电脑中彻底删除上述内容资源!如用于商业或者非法用途,与本站无关,一切后果请用户自负!
4. 如果您也有好的资源或教程,您可以投稿发布,成功分享后有积分奖励和额外收入!
5.严禁将资源用于任何违法犯罪行为,不得违反国家法律,否则责任自负,一切法律责任与本站无关